Background technique
It presses, circuit board is the supporter of electronic building brick, throughout route to connect each electronic building brick on circuit board.And in order to It connects each circuit board or connection circuit board and other electronic building bricks, circuit board then needs to be connected by component is welded and fixed It connects.
This kind of circuit-board connecting structure includes usually plating hole on circuit boards, and component is welded and fixed by welding column The plating hole is crossed in break-through, and has a circular pad on component is welded and fixed.When be welded and fixed component and circuit board connects When connecing, material (tin cream) is connect by tin, round pad, welding column and circuit board are subjected to fusion connection.
However, such circuit-board connecting structure is relatively easy after carry out system verifying to be welded and fixed what component fell off Problem, it is abnormal that this bad result causes part to loosen etc..Through investigation analysis result be welded and fixed component adhesive force it is insufficient, and Because the excessive generation impact of strength falls and generates this undesirable result.

Specific embodiment
To reach above-mentioned purpose and effect, the technical means and structures that the present invention uses, the just present invention that hereby draws are preferable Its feature and function of embodiment elaborate are as follows, understand completely in order to sharp.
It please refers to shown in Fig. 1~3, is the perspective view one, two that modular construction preferred embodiment is welded and fixed according to the present invention And cross-sectional view.It can be clearly seen from the figure that modular construction is welded and fixed in one kind of the present invention, to be fixed on a circuit board 1, So-called circuit board 1 can be printed circuit board 1 (Printed circuit board), for supporting electronic building brick, the circuit board There is a plating hole 11 on 1.This be welded and fixed component 2 include: a body of rod 21, the fixed glue 23 in an annular abutment portion 22, one with An and ring projection 24.
21 one end of the body of rod is to pass through the plating hole 11.In this present embodiment, which is cylindrical body, if it His shape should also be feasible scheme.
The annular abutment portion 22 is set on the body of rod 21, to be resisted against on the circuit board 1, corresponding to being somebody's turn to do for cylindrical body The body of rod 21, the annular abutment portion 22 can be annular shape, should also be feasible scheme if other shapes.The annular abutment portion 22 it Bottom surface has a cyclic annular notch 221.And so-called cyclic annular notch 221, it is in this present embodiment inclined-plane aspect.
The fixation glue 23 is to be filled between the annular abutment portion 22 and the circuit board 1 and be filled in the circuit board 1 Between the body of rod 21.In this present embodiment, which is tin cream, and via high temperature contact, the fixation glue 23 is variable to be turned to Molten condition.
The ring projection 24 is set on the body of rod 21, and is set to the lower section in the annular abutment portion 22, to hinder The fixation glue 23 is kept off to overflow downwards.
It is designed by above-mentioned structure, composition, hereby being described as follows using actuation situation with regard to the present invention: please refer to figure It is the implementation diagram one that modular construction preferred embodiment is welded and fixed according to the present invention shown in 4a.Firstly, when being intended to carry out this hair When the bright connection that component 2 and circuit board 1 is welded and fixed, the fixed glue 23 of 11 edge filling of plating hole first on the circuit card 1.Please It is the implementation diagram two that modular construction preferred embodiment is welded and fixed according to the present invention simultaneously refering to shown in Fig. 4 b.Then, will One end of the body of rod 21 passes through the plating hole 11.Please refer to shown in Fig. 4 c, for component knot is welded and fixed according to the present invention The implementation diagram three of structure preferred embodiment.When one of the body of rod 21 support it is continuous penetrate the plating hole 11 when, the annular abutment The bottom surface in portion 22 can touch fixed glue 23, meanwhile, fixed glue 23 is also because be squeezed, so that fixing glue 23 towards circuit board It is overflowed downwards between 1 and the body of rod 21.Please refer to shown in Fig. 4 d, preferably implement for modular construction is welded and fixed according to the present invention The implementation diagram four of example.Due to the ring projection 24 be set to the position on the body of rod 21 be the plating hole 11 in, when When fixed glue 23 overflows downwards, the blocking of the ring projection 24 will receive, and fixed glue 23 may make not continue to underflow Out.
It should be strongly noted that the bottom surface in the present invention annular abutment portion 22 has cyclic annular notch 221, and the ring-type Notch 221 is inclined-plane aspect.When the fixation glue 23 of molten condition, which is under pressure, to be overflowed around, the design of this inclined-plane aspect can To force the fixation glue 23 of molten condition to be diffused towards center position.And due in the annular abutment portion 22 of the body of rod 21 Lower section there is ring projection 24, the position of the ring projection 24 is not less than 1 bottom of circuit board, can effectively increase The uniformity of the fixation glue 23 and keep the fixation glue 23 will not downwards slime flux go out.It is verified by practical operation, present invention welding Fixation kit structure can increase connection pulling force really, and have feasibility and practicability.
